Bartolo Colon held a Marlins split-squad to two runs in 6 2/3 innings in the Mets' 10-2 win Saturday.
Colon also had a hit today. The portly 40-year-old hasn't had one in a regular-season game since 2005, and he's just 10-for-96 with 56 strikeouts lifetime. The Mets could care less if he makes outs at the same rate this year; they just don't want him to get hurt swinging or running the bases.

Bartolo Colon allowed four runs on seven hits over 4 2/3 innings against the Cubs Saturday.
Two of the seven hits found the bleachers, raising his spring ERA to 7.27. The right-hander didn't strike out a single batter over his 4 2/3 innings. Despite his struggles, his spot in the rotation isn't in danger.

Bartolo Colon surrendered three runs and five hits in four innings Monday versus the Marlins.
Colon was making his spring debut after suffering from some calf tightness last month. Obviously, he managed to continue building stamina during his absence -- he wouldn't have pitched four innings today if not -- but the Mets didn't want him having to field his position until he was past the tightness.

Bartolo Colon (calf) threw 54 pitches in a scrimmage on Thursday morning in Mets camp.
Colon is hoping to make his Grapefruit League debut on Monday. He came down with some calf tightness at the end of February, so the Mets have been moving him along slowly. The veteran right-hander signed a two-year, $20 million contract with New York in December.

Bartolo Colon's representatives are asking for a two-year deal, according to ESPN's Buster Olney.
And there's enough interest in the 40-year-old right-hander that it seems feasible. Colon posted a 2.65 ERA and 117/29 K/BB ratio in 190 1/3 innings this past season for the A's. He has been linked to the Orioles, Rangers, Mets, Mariners and Orioles, among others.
